Denarius of Hadrian (76–138; Roman emperor 117–138). Obverse: head of Hadrian in laurel wreath facing right; rim inscription HADRIANVS AVGVSTVS. Reverse: Pudicitia (personification) seated left, wearing a long dress and veil, holding her veil with her right hand and left hand on her knee; rim inscription COS III. Date: 125–128. Place: Rome, Roman Empire (27 BC–476). Coin; weight 3.40 g.
